Is a house a better investment than stock?

Is a house a better investment than stock?

Real estate investments can be more work than stocks. While purchasing property is easy to understand, that doesn’t mean the work of maintaining properties, especially rental properties, is easy. Owning properties requires much more sweat equity than purchasing stock or stock investments like mutual funds.

What is a good return on real estate investment?

A good ROI for a rental property is usually above 10\%, but 5\% to 10\% is also an acceptable range. Remember, there is no right or wrong answer when it comes to calculating the ROI. Different investors take different levels of risk, which is why knowing your budget and analyzing the potential return is imperative.

What are the benefits of investing in real estate?

Real estate investors have the ability to gain leverage on their capital and take advantage of substantial tax benefits. 1  Although real estate is not nearly as liquid as the stock market, the long-term cash flow provides passive income and the promise of appreciation.
